STADIUM VÉLODROME
Read moreThe Velodrome Stadium is this unmissable pyramid-shaped building in Bordeaux-Lac! It houses: 1 cycling track of 250 m, 1 elliptical track of 200 m, 1 speed track of 60 m, a high jump, long jump and pole vault, shot put equipment, archery, table tennis, six badminton courts and 4,560 seats in bleachers. SPORT-BALL-ANGLET
Read moreThis sports complex is dedicated to JorkyBall, Racketball and Jiu-Jitsu. Jorkyball, also known as 2-a-side soccer, is a team sport derived from soccer and inspired by squash, created in 1987. Racketball is played with a tennis racket with a shorter handle and a larger ball than squash and faster than tennis. LE BIARRITZ ATHLETIC CLUB
Read moreThe sports complex features a long left-hand wall known as jaï-alaï for cesta punta, seating 1,800, a short left-hand wall for pala, paleta and bare hands, and a trinquet for bare hands and paleta. The club regularly fields players from all disciplines in competition. It was the1st to set up a cesta punta school in 1956, and since 1962, BAC members have been taking part in the world championships of this discipline, a sport that is also played abroad.
